Heads up for your first month: our landlord, Farrowgate Estates, runs a site audit every quarter, and the next one lands during your onboarding window. Auditors will be walking the floors with clipboards — totally normal, just badge them through politely if asked. They'll want to see the plant room too, which stays locked. The plant room door takes the code below.

door code, kawip-bagap: bdg-HQEWH-4

Ticket #4471 — Replica lag alarm blocked by locked vault

The read-replica lag alarm for the Quillmere metrics store fired at 03:10 and auto-remediation stalled because the Hollowpine vault sealed itself after three failed unlock attempts. Plugin authors: your hooks will see stale reads until we reopen it. Remediation requires the vault recovery passphrase, which the on-call rotation keeps below.

vault phrase of tajop-haduf = holath-brivan-wenax

Subject: Health checks — read before your first shift

Welcome to Bridgelark on-call. Quick facts: the load balancer probes /healthz every 10s, two consecutive failures pull a node from rotation. Plugin endpoints are probed separately; if your plugin blocks the health handler, your node gets yanked and you get paged. Keep handlers under 200ms and never touch the database in them. Deep checks run on a separate port. Probe configs, timeouts, and the drain procedure are documented on the internal page below.

dashboard of tawef-hagug = https://superset.norvadyn.local/display/projects/build/ticket/build/spaces/ticket/1e989f0e6c200d20fc4ae06b

Action item from the Fernhollow outage: the Quellbird alert deduplicator collapsed distinct incidents into one page because fingerprints ignored the affected cluster field. We will add cluster identity to the fingerprint and add a regression test for multi-cluster storms. New team members should review how fingerprints are composed before modifying alert rules. The deduplication design notes are on the internal page below.

operations page: https://jenkins.zemvarcloud.local/job/merge_requests/repo/build/73930b4b30f0a8ed